Sho Nakamori

Career Highlights

  • 2011 Pan American Games team bronze medalist
  • 2009 NCAA team champion
  • 2009 Winter Cup all-around bronze medalist
  • 2008 NCAA team silver medalist and pommel horse bronze medalist
  • Alternate on the 2007 World Championships team
  • 2007 National all-around and high bar bronze medalist
  • 2004 Winter Cup Challenge pommel horse bronze medalist
  • 2003 Pan American Games team bronze medalist

Personal Information

  • Hometown: Albany, CA
  • Personal Website: www.shonakamori.com
  • Name of College: Stanford University
